    Chief Executive Officer

    Job Description

    • We are looking for a Chief Executive Officer who will manage our company's overall operations. This will include delegating and directing agendas, driving business growth, providing strategic, financial, and operational leadership for the company while working with the Board of Directors and senior leadership team.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Developing high-quality business strategies and plans that are in alignment with the company’s overall short-term and long-term objectives
    • Driving revenue growth, profitability, and company values to ensure consistent results and exponential growth
    • Leading the transformation of client projects from vision to a scaled and constructed solution for African women within and outside of our community
    • Nurturing existing partner relationships and identifying new business opportunities with potential clients to drive growth for the business
    • Cultivating a high-performing and agile team culture
    • Driving day-to-day operations
    • Aligning existing resources to achieve key business goals
    • Owning the organizational operational budget and managing burn rate
    • Managing competition and threats in the marketplace, with constant evaluation of our financial structure and capital strategy
    • Providing expert guidance to all departments, including operations, sales, marketing and programs
    • Reporting strategic updates to the Board of Directors and corporate stakeholders regarding progress on quarterly goals
    • Being the public champion/ambassador for the business
    • Establishing credibility within our customer and partner network

    Head of Programs

    Job Description

    • The Head of Programs will be responsible for organizing and generating revenue from SLA offline / online programs, managing projects from end to end, developing relationships with brands and identifying additional revenue streams for the company.

    Specific Responsibilities
    Events:

    • Organizing programs and activities in accordance with the mission and goals of the organization.
    • Work closely with project sponsors, cross-functional teams, and assigned project managers to plan and develop scope, deliverables, required resources, work plan, budget, and timing for new initiatives.
    • Secure event partnerships that involve research, conference calls, proposals and in-person meetings.
    • Serve as a spokesperson for official events and programs.

    Project Management:

    • Overseeing the successful launch of products
    • Understanding how different projects interlink and overlap
    • Developing an evaluation method to assess program strengths and identify areas for improvement.
    • Implementing and managing changes and interventions to ensure project goals are achieved.
    • Producing accurate and timely reporting of program status throughout its life cycle.
    • Analyze, evaluate, and overcome program risks, and produce program reports for management and stakeholders.
    • Liaising with the marketing and communications team to increase awareness of programs

    Strategy Formulation:

    • Developing and implementing strategies for the programs team, including developing a robust risk mitigation plan for different projects

    Team Management:

    • Manage the programs team for optimal return-on-investment, and coordinate and delegate cross-project initiatives
    • Communicating and coordinating event targets with the Marketing and Sales team

    Budgeting and Financing:

    • Managing budgets and reporting on fund allocation

    HGCP:

    • Conduct customer development research to identify the skills and training our community is looking for and integrate that into our programs
    • Develop content for the platform
    • Manage and engage with relevant content partners, set-up meetings, and drive short and long-term goals for the success of the platform
